图书馆管理系统设计与实现_论文


时间: 2021-06-21 21:10:09 人气: 10 评论: 0

摘  要

防灾科技学院图书管理系统是根据防灾科技学院现有图书资料以及教师、学生关联的借书还书管理系统。该系统是采用C#做前台,采用SQL Server 2008作为后台数据库,在Microsoft Visual 2010下编译的系统。本系统提供6个功能模块,分别是图书类别管理模块、图书信息管理模块、读者信息管理模块、新书订购管理模块、图书借阅模块以及系统维护模块。这6个模块里又有许多子模块,通过这些模块之间的相互连接配合,完成操作员发出的各种指令。

图书管理系统是一个供图书馆工作人员使用的系统。图书馆的工作人员有两类,一类是前台操作人员,负责图书的借阅和归还工作;另一类是系统管理员,除了操作人员的所有功能外,还能够对书籍列表、书籍信息、读者信息等进行管理。


关键词:图书管理系统;SQL Server 2008;C#

软件分析过程中,我们进行一步到库的工作步骤的分析,获得其功能要求。功能的软件需求分析是分析,这是在设置软件的结构的一个关键因素的重要组成部分。

总之,要满足的系统的基本要求如下:

(1)登录功能模块

该系统是用于管理管理系统,专门设计的,所以其他人没有操作该系统的权限,设置登录模块是实现这一特性。通过获得该系统的初始操作,以实现操作权限的系统设置安全性项目管理员密码。

(2)基本设置模块

该模块是基本操作模块管理员制度,包括书籍和其他信息的收集。

(3)每天处理模块

该模块是日常事务的管理每天出现的管理,如添加的书架信息,一些日常工作,库项目管理和用户公告板消息管理。

(4)报告模块

该模块提供了许多书籍信息表和用户信息表,以查看,打印功能,便于管理员分析过程的信息,以便完成更好的管理。



目   录

引言 1

1 绪论 1

1.1 研究背景 1

1.2 研究意义 1

1.3 图书管理系统现状分析 1

1.4 论文框架 2

2 系统需求分析 2

2.1 需求分析 3

2.2  可行性分析 4

2.3  业务流程图 4

2.4  程序流程图 5

2.5  系统数据流程图 5

3  系统概要设计 6

3.1  .NET介绍 6

3.2  SQL SERVER 2008数据库 7

3.3  C#语言 8

3.4  基于C/S的三层架构体系 9

4  系统详细设计 10

4.1  软件模块设计 10

4.2  数据库设计 11

5  系统界面设计 14

5.1  界面设计思想 14

5.2  详细界面设计 15

6  系统测试及评价 19

6.1  测试内容 19

6.2  测试环境 19

6.3  测试方法 20

6.4  系统评价 20

6.5  开发过程的总结 20

7 结论 21

致谢 21

参考文献 21


评论
188083800